Structure and Operation of a Transformer
A transformer essentially consists of two coils: the primary (input) coil and the secondary (output) coil. These coils are wound around an iron core. When electric current flows through the primary coil, a magnetic field is created, which induces a new electric current in the secondary coil. This process either increases or decreases the voltage.

Importance of Transformers
Electric power plants typically generate electricity at high voltage. However, the electricity delivered to our homes and schools must be at a much lower voltage. Transformers perform this conversion, ensuring that electricity can be used safely. They also reduce energy losses.
